Name - "official" name and what they were known as
Herbert Edward Crisp, “Bert”

Date and place of birth
30 Aug 1898, West Wittering, Sussex, bap 13 Nov 1898 at SS Peter & Paul, West Wittering son of William James & Harriott Elizabeth, father’s occupation: Independent

Names of parents
William James Crisp (http://www.genealogistsforum.co.uk/forum/showthread.php?t=2211&highlight=william+james+crisp)& Harriott Elizabeth (nee Badcock) (http://www.genealogistsforum.co.uk/forum/showthread.php?t=2017&highlight=harriott+elizabeth+badcock)

Details of each of his or her marriages - if any - and any divorces
25 April 1929 at East Wittering parish church to Adela Rose Steel

Occupation(s) - if any
Carpenter in business with his brother Lawrence, volunteer fireman and school caretaker. In WW1 before joining the army he made wooden propellers for aircraft in Leagrave
.
Military service - if any
WW1: joined the West Wittering Volunteer Training Corps at its inaugural meeting 28 Nov 1924, aged 16, along with his father and brother Lawrence/
WW1: Gunner, Royal Field Artillery regtl no 218785
WW2: too old, worked making MTBs

Addresses where they lived - and please list which censuses you have or haven't found him/her on, if applicable.
1901: Myrtle Cottage, West Wittering
1911: Myrtle Cottage, West Wittering
1921: Myrtle Cottage with mother, oldest brother, sister Elsie and two visitors, sister Beatrice and her son. Employed as a carpenter by brother Lawrence.
1929ish: Little Cott, Shore Road, East Wittering (demolished, Munneries is built on the site)
Later 1930s Admiralty Row, East Wittering, one of the smaller houses in the terrace
1939 onward: 7 Admiralty Row

Date, place and cause of death
Nov 1975, hospital in Chichester district, can't remember the date. It was a weekday. I was 15.

Date and place of burial / cremation.
Chichester Crematorium, ashes scattered Chichester harbour near the end of Ellanore Lane, the perfect place.
